Can a lithium-ion battery be packed in a checked bag?

A view of a security officer examining a suitcase at a security checkpoint in the airport terminal. TSA’s updated policy mandates that any item powered by a lithium-ion battery be packed in carry-on luggage, not in checked bags. These batteries are commonly found in a range of personal electronics and portable charging devices.

Do you need lithium batteries in a carry-on bag?

If asked to check your carry-on bag, you’ll need to remove all lithium batteries (as listed above) and keep those on board with you. “This covers spare lithium metal and spare rechargeable lithium-ion batteries for personal electronics such as cameras, cell phones, laptop computers, tablets, watches, calculators, etc.

Can you travel with lithium ion batteries?

Since some devices use lithium ion batteries, you cannot travel with them in your checked bags. You can travel with them in your carry-on, but you’re not allowed to use them on board any flight.
